Ryan Farquhar at Hillberry, he’s doing about 120mph and came past at no more than arm lengths away. Got loads of images of empty roads before getting this one.
Dave Molyneux at the top of Bray Hill, broke the lap records with an avarage lap speed of nearly 116mph, the side cars are a bit slower than the solos, he’s just doing about 140mph in a 30mph zone. The quick solos will be doing around 165mph with the front wheel up in the air as they cross the traffic lights.

Yes I managed to have a few trips around the circuit, the majority of the circuit now has speed limits imposed on it with just a few small sections displaying the national speed limit sign (ie no speed limit over there) all except the mountain section which is still ‘no limit’. There are alot more speed restrictions now than there was the first time I went (1997). I tended to ride round early in the morning while everyone else was getting over their hangovers.
